FavouritesAdd to Wish List
FavouritesAdd to Wish List
Trusted teacher
from30.74USD/ h

Math, Computer Sciences/Programming, French, Physics

My formation in engineering school (Information Technology at the ÉTS in Montreal, Canada), techinian school (GEII at the IUT de Cachan, France) and my previous placements experiences (Croesus Finansoft and the National Institute of Sports) helped me specialize myself in Math, Physics and Computer Sciences.

I'm able to teach and help the students in Math, Physics and the basic of Computer Sciences (depending on the student's level). The focus of the class is to develop the ability to learn, think and solve problems.

As for the Computer Sciences class, you will learn the basics of current programming languages such as C/C++, Java, Python, Objective C (IOS programming).

At the end of the class you could have some homeworks to do for the next session. These would help you to assimilate the subject previously learned.

Extra information

Bring your own laptop.
You can bring your own homeworks.

Location

At student's location: Around London, United Kingdom

|
Use ⊞+wheel to zoom!
+

General info

Age:
Children (7-12 years old)
Teenagers (13-17 years old)
Adults (18-64 years old)
Seniors (65+ years old)
Student level:
Beginner
Intermediate
Duration:
30 minutes
45 minutes
60 minutes
90 minutes
120 minutes
The class is taught in:English, French

Ask a question

Send a message explaining your needs and Francois will reply soon:
The more detail, the better.
Ex. "Hi, when are you available to meet for a lesson?"

Availability of a typical week

(GMT -04:00) New York
MonTueWedThuFriSatSun
0              
1              
2              
3              
4              
5            Saturday at 5:00  Sunday at 5:00
6            Saturday at 6:00  Sunday at 6:00
7            Saturday at 7:00  Sunday at 7:00
8            Saturday at 8:00  Sunday at 8:00
9            Saturday at 9:00  Sunday at 9:00
10            Saturday at 10:00  Sunday at 10:00
11            Saturday at 11:00  Sunday at 11:00
12            Saturday at 12:00  Sunday at 12:00
13            Saturday at 13:00  Sunday at 13:00
14  Monday at 14:00  Tuesday at 14:00  Wednesday at 14:00  Thursday at 14:00  Friday at 14:00  Saturday at 14:00  Sunday at 14:00
15  Monday at 15:00  Tuesday at 15:00  Wednesday at 15:00  Thursday at 15:00  Friday at 15:00  Saturday at 15:00  Sunday at 15:00
16  Monday at 16:00  Tuesday at 16:00  Wednesday at 16:00  Thursday at 16:00  Friday at 16:00  Saturday at 16:00  Sunday at 16:00
17  Monday at 17:00  Tuesday at 17:00  Wednesday at 17:00  Thursday at 17:00  Friday at 17:00    
18              
19              
20              
21              
22              
23              
from $30.74At student's home

Good-fit Instructor Guarantee


If you are not satisfied after your first lesson, Apprentus will find you another instructor or will refund your first lesson.

Online reputation

  • Instructor since May 2017

Availability of a typical week

(GMT -04:00) New York
MonTueWedThuFriSatSun
0              
1              
2              
3              
4              
5            Saturday at 5:00  Sunday at 5:00
6            Saturday at 6:00  Sunday at 6:00
7            Saturday at 7:00  Sunday at 7:00
8            Saturday at 8:00  Sunday at 8:00
9            Saturday at 9:00  Sunday at 9:00
10            Saturday at 10:00  Sunday at 10:00
11            Saturday at 11:00  Sunday at 11:00
12            Saturday at 12:00  Sunday at 12:00
13            Saturday at 13:00  Sunday at 13:00
14  Monday at 14:00  Tuesday at 14:00  Wednesday at 14:00  Thursday at 14:00  Friday at 14:00  Saturday at 14:00  Sunday at 14:00
15  Monday at 15:00  Tuesday at 15:00  Wednesday at 15:00  Thursday at 15:00  Friday at 15:00  Saturday at 15:00  Sunday at 15:00
16  Monday at 16:00  Tuesday at 16:00  Wednesday at 16:00  Thursday at 16:00  Friday at 16:00  Saturday at 16:00  Sunday at 16:00
17  Monday at 17:00  Tuesday at 17:00  Wednesday at 17:00  Thursday at 17:00  Friday at 17:00    
18              
19              
20              
21              
22              
23              
from $30.74At student's home

Good-fit Instructor Guarantee


If you are not satisfied after your first lesson, Apprentus will find you another instructor or will refund your first lesson.

Share


Mavi
Math, Physics and Science tutoring for children and teenagers: IB MYP, IGCSE, and GCSE.
I am Mavi, a physics engineer working at an aerospace company. I have been teaching private lessons at the primary, secondary, high school, and university preparatory levels for 9 years. I teach mathematics, physics, chemistry, and science. I have a good command of the curricula of IB, IGCSE, American, Hong Kong, and international schools. Additionally, I hold the position of president at the Astronomy Society, where I foster my students' interest in astronomy and science beyond the lessons. I prepare the learning environment by incorporating experiments and exploration, moving away from rote education. I often bring experimental materials to class, aiming to make learning memorable through hands-on experiments. As an educational mentor, I approach my students as if they were my siblings, valuing creativity. I have a deep passion for mathematics, physics, and science. I am dedicated to helping students understand and learn because life encompasses both SCIENCE and ART. The more people I can inspire to know, understand, and love mathematics, physics, and chemistry, the more proud I am. Are you curious about how nature works? Let's explore together!

Oliver
Every child is a math genius | British tutor
When I was a young child, I believed I was not a mathematical person. It wasn't until I met an amazing teacher at age 15 that I discovered my mathematical genius and my life was changed forever. I'm eternally grateful to that teacher. My teacher knew that self-image and self-belief is the key to unlocking your child's mathematical abilities. Everyone is good at maths, but we all have different styles of thinking. Bad teachers teach every child the same way. My job is to find your child's style of mathematics and allow him to discover that for himself. When he discovers that, he will begin to enjoy the beauty and power of mathematics...and then you will see as the grades begin to soar. 👉Click the blue "Contact Oliver" button above and let's discuss how we can unlock your child's mathematical talents! 😊

Fanny
Fun French lessons for children; exams : A level, (I)GCSE, Common Entrance; French lessons for adults
I teach French in a fun way with songs, games and activities for children 1 to 12 y.o. I help prepare UK French exams like Common Entrance, (I)GCSE and A level I teach adults, beginners and intermediate learners, we'll work on making you confident in Speak in French Do not hesitate to contact me to have lessons tailored to your needs

Mounir
Intensive preparation for the Bac and Brevet 2024: Exceptional mathematics courses
I am a qualified engineer from Arts et Métiers ParisTech and followed a preparatory class, accumulating more than 10 years of experience as a private mathematics teacher. My goal is to help your child reach their full academic potential in mathematics and develop skills that will prepare them for a bright future. Why choose my courses? Would you like your child to: Significantly improve your results in mathematics/physics-chemistry? Join a selective curriculum? Become independent and confident in your abilities? Over the last 5 years, I have had the privilege of supporting more than 30 French students, from middle school (sixth, fifth, fourth, third) to high school (second, first, terminale), towards academic success. My students obtained good averages, passed the certificate, the baccalaureate and the preparatory classes, while strengthening their self-confidence. My teaching method in 3 steps: Short term: Immediate improvement in average by assimilating the course and preparing for assessments. This includes assimilating the course, taking notes, practicing standard exercises, anticipating teachers' expectations and test questions, as well as acquiring writing methods. Medium term: Integration of reasoning and working methods. Your child will learn to work regularly in this order: assimilation, training exercises, preparation for assessments and analysis of results. Long term: Establishing clear goals, building the steps to achieve them, realizing the SIMPLICITY of mathematics, building confidence in your abilities and unlocking your child's potential. Details of the formula: One to two sessions of 1h30/2h per week to assimilate the course and prepare for the evaluations. Classes delivered via Google Meet for effective online learning. Use of a virtual whiteboard to facilitate the assimilation of concepts. Access to an online library including 10 mathematics reference books. Over 1000 online exercises to strengthen math skills. Questions ? Contact me now on Apprentus, and I will respond quickly. Together, we can give your child the future they deserve through an exceptional math education. Don't let this opportunity pass you by! Book today for outstanding results in mathematics. Excellence Math, Physics, Chemistry - 19 average - New program 2023 Give your child the future they deserve with exceptional math lessons!

Julien
Private Science Lessons - Mathematics, Chemistry, Physics
Dear student, I am a chemist who has graduated from EPFL (Swiss Federal Institute of Technology). I have always been fascinated by science, and I now hold a doctorate in solid-state physics from the University of Geneva. Science subjects can greatly assist you in passing your exams. I have been teaching these disciplines for many years, conducting exercise sessions both at the university and in private lessons as an independent tutor. For this reason, you will have the opportunity to request explanations on any subject. It is indeed beneficial for you to make progress based on your existing knowledge. You can choose to receive remedial lessons to review or explore entire chapters. Before the first lesson commences, I will invite you to freely and openly share your situation, enabling us to work effectively from the very first session. All scientific subjects share a common method known as "scientific logic." Whenever possible, I will provide you with elements of this method, as it will enable you to gain a lasting understanding and solve exercises rigorously. Your studies are of utmost importance, and it is crucial that you are taken seriously. Best regards, Julien

Ambre
French lessons with a native speaker For every level
As a native French speaker living in such a cosmopolitan and diverse city as London, I believe that a lot of people would like to learn French. The first meeting we would evaluate your level with a simple conversation to get to know each other and see if we’re compatible as a student/teacher, and start planning a timeline for your objectives. Then I will adapt the class depending on your level, your expectations. It could be either conversations to practice speaking, more school-oriented classes, more work-oriented ones...

Aniket
Oracle Certified Tutor/Trainer For Java, Python and Web with 300+ Reviews
- B.tech and M.tech in Computer Science - Worked as a Software engineer in Virtusa Corp & DIGIDEZ - More than 6 years of teaching experience - Oracle Certified Developer - Helped students placed in FAANG Featured Review : Been trying to learn Java on my own for about 1 year and I couldn't get a grasp on it. Aniket make learning Java a fun experience and challenges you to think for yourself to reinforce the concepts you've learned. I am truly excited for our meetings and he makes time go by so fast that I'm upset when they end. Great teacher and he is genuinely passionate about your success. If I could give him more stars I would!!! Thanks Aniket

Gohar
French /delf/dalf french classes online , professional teacher
French classes online, if you are interested in learning french then you are on right way . I've been teaching french since 2014 , I am certified french teacher , I offer professional language classes , and guarantue perfect result. I am patient and I try to motivate my students in learning process . My classes are interesting and full of energy , I teach all levels , no age restriction , for students who need to be prepared for their exams , for pupils , for professionals who need french, and just for those who are wiling to learn frecnh

Christophe
French: written/oral expression, grammar, conversation
Do you want to start learning French but have never learnt it before? Or maybe you want to perfect your understanding of French grammar, or your capacity to express yourself clearly, spontaneously and with confidence in French? Or work on pronunciation, perhaps improve your accent and learn more about French culture? I can help you with all of these, and not only because I was born and raised in France: after getting my Master's Degree in Lingustics and Anthropology from the School for Advanced Research in Paris - at the time I was also teaching private classes of French and English to high school and university students - I moved to the UK and studied theatre at the Royal Conservatoire of Scotland. There I worked on the skills any speaker needs to communicate clearly and convincingly: diction, voice projection, etc. These two approaches - linguistics, and theatre work - give me a strong foundation from which to help any student learn French. So jump on: we'll build a learning program tailored to your needs and make sure that the lessons are both dense and fun.

Ayoub
Main Teacher _ Physics-Chemistry Course, Mathematics
It is important to me to teach my students while adopting an active teaching method. I put all my experience acquired as a teacher at MEN to the service of their success. My seriousness, my listening and my kindness allow me to overcome difficulties and excel in: - Math, - Chemical Physics, My courses are aimed at students in the French system from 6th to 12th grade (Speciality: Mathematics, PC)

Emna
[PYTHON - Data Science - AI] Learn Python & Data Science & Artificial Intelligence from beginner to advanced
You are a highschool student? You have a baccalaureate? You need help with Python (Algorithmic Programming). I am here to teach you ! I am certified from Python Institute (PCAP: Certified Associate in Python Programming) and I work with Python for more than 5 years. I am also a teacher and my students love the way I teach with (simple, clear and always funny)

Gabriel
Cambridge Graduate & Google Developer - Programming Tutoring 1 on 1
I am a Cambridge graduate in CS, with over 10 medals and national distinctions for competitive programming. For over 5 years, I have helped hundreds of students discover how easy and beautiful Computer Science is: - Assisted students in improving from a C to an A* grade. - Helped motivated students qualify for the National Informatics Olympiad. - Guided many achieve their target grades in A-Levels, even attaining the perfect score. - Prepared for IB/IA, A-Levels, GCSE, University Entry, or equivalent. - Assisted with specific projects at a professional level, including interview preparation. All my success in Computer Science is due to my teachers, who knew how to inspire my passion and turn any concept into an easy-to-understand story. That's why I decided to help others further to elucidate the secrets of Computer Science and to smile with relief in the exam hall when they notice that they know how to solve all the subjects perfectly. It's amazing how quickly a student can progress when the material is explained to them in their understanding. I have a highly flexible schedule and can adapt to accommodate your needs. If you have any questions about my teaching method, availability, or pricing, please don't hesitate to reach out. I am here to assist you and provide the support you need :).

Sarah
French and English lessons for all levels + preparation for the GCSE
As a recent graduate from a Master degree in teaching English, with 5 years of experience tutoring French children and students privately. During my two years of master, I taught English to secondary school students. The theory and the practise, allowed me to develop my teaching skills and through tutoring I have learned to tailor my teaching methods to the student’s needs. Moreover, throughout my years of tutoring, I could gave back the confidence that students were lacking in their education, which led to one of my students to obtain her “brevet” equivalent of the English GSCE with a high grade. The success was hinged through the learning material that I created. Indeed, I produced my own lesson plans and I provided weekly progress homework.

Chloé
I am Native and I give French course - for beginner and confirmed + translation + exam preparation - (DILF, DELF, DALF and certification FLE)
You want to learn French ? (for children, students and adults) You really want to improve your French (speaking and writing) ? I am native and I give French lessons in London for beginners and advanced. I also give classes in maths, physics, French, philosophy and Spanish for French students in London who pass the baccalauréat. I have elaborated my own method to teach grammar, conjugation, vocabulary, writing, speaking and listening (oral comprehension). I give my own exercises. I also teach French civilisation - which is a crucial element to learn and understand French. I can also write and translate your resume from English to French or from French to English and cover letters. I give French classes for all ages and for children(people in school (primary school, high school), students (in university or school).

Maiko
Introduction to Python Programming (algorithms, structures, abstractions)
<Course Description> This course is designed for beginners who are interested in learning programming with Python. It covers the basic concepts of programming such as data types, variables, control structures, functions, and file I/O. Participants will learn how to write Python programs, debug code, and design algorithms using Python. The course also introduces the basics of object-oriented programming and the Python libraries used for data manipulation and visualization. <Prerequisites> No prior programming experience is required. However, familiarity with basic computer concepts such as files, folders, and operating systems is recommended. <Learning Objectives> By the end of the course, participants will be able to: * Understand the fundamentals of programming and how it applies to Python * Write Python code for simple applications and automate repetitive tasks * Use control structures such as loops and conditional statements * Create functions to encapsulate code and enable code reuse * Work with Python libraries such as NumPy, Pandas, and Matplotlib * Use object-oriented programming principles to design more complex programs * Debug code and use error-handling techniques <Course Outline> The course is divided into modules that build on each other to provide a comprehensive introduction to Python programming. Each module consists of lectures, demonstrations, hands-on exercises, and quizzes to reinforce learning. Here is an outline of the course: Module 1: Introduction to Python History and Overview of Python Setting up Python environment Writing and running basic Python programs Variables, data types, and operators Module 2: Control Structures Conditional statements and Boolean logic Loops and iteration User input and output Module 3: Functions Writing and calling functions Scope and namespaces Return values and parameters Lambda functions Module 4: File Input and Output Reading and writing files File modes and buffering Handling exceptions and errors Module 5: Object-Oriented Programming Classes and objects Inheritance and polymorphism Data encapsulation and abstraction Special methods and decorators Module 6: Python Libraries Introduction to NumPy, Pandas, and Matplotlib Data manipulation and analysis with Pandas Data visualization with Matplotlib Conclusion This beginner's programming class in Python provides a solid foundation for anyone interested in learning programming and using Python for data analysis, automation, or software development. With hands-on exercises, interactive quizzes, and a comprehensive final project, participants will learn how to write Python code that is efficient, maintainable, and elegant.